Spanish women transform summer shade into public art with giant crochet canopy in Malaga

In southern Spain, where intense summer temperatures often reshape daily life, a group of local women turned a practical problem into a striking example of community creativity.

In the town of Alhaurín de la Torre in Malaga, crochet teacher Eva Pacheco and her students created a massive hand-crocheted canopy to provide shade over a central shopping street, replacing conventional plastic coverings with an artistic and more environmentally conscious alternative.

The large-scale installation, made from hundreds of crocheted squares joined together in patchwork form, spans nearly 500 square meters and now offers both sun protection and visual beauty for residents and visitors.

Rather than relying solely on industrial materials, the project transformed traditional needlework into urban design — combining sustainability, craftsmanship and public space improvement.

Featuring geometric designs, organic forms and vibrant colors chosen by the participants, the canopy not only shields pedestrians from the heat but also reflects local identity and collaborative effort.

For many observers, the project stands out as an example of how traditional crafts can be reimagined in modern civic life, especially in regions facing extreme summer conditions.

Across parts of Spain, heat adaptation has become an increasingly important part of urban planning, and initiatives like this demonstrate how grassroots creativity can contribute to sustainable cooling solutions while preserving cultural traditions.

The crocheted canopy has also drawn admiration for showcasing the social value of communal art, where practical infrastructure becomes an expression of local talent rather than disposable utility.

Beyond shade, the installation highlights broader conversations around eco-friendly materials, public art investment and the revival of handmade crafts in contemporary design.

In a season often defined by heat, this project has offered something more than relief — it has provided a model for how communities can blend sustainability with beauty.

Why creative urban cooling solutions matter

As global temperatures rise, cities worldwide are increasingly exploring alternatives to heat-heavy infrastructure, including sustainable shade systems, eco-friendly architecture and community-led environmental design. Projects like this one show how local art, low-waste materials and traditional skills may play a growing role in future climate adaptation strategies.
